Odalovic: These are the sleepless nights of the Serbs of Kosovo and Metohija

Veljko Odalović / Photo: Nedim Grabovica / Avalon / Profimedia

The President of the Commission for Missing Persons of the Government of Serbia, Veljko Odalović, told RTS that Albin Kurti continuously destabilizes the situation in Kosovo and Metohija, provokes and abuses everything he can to bring as much insecurity to the north of Kosovo and Metohija and among all Serbs.

"Once again we have the same or similar rhetoric from the centers that very often call him not to do something that he did. It is also Quinta and the USA and the EU. It's something they don't approve of and didn't agree to, but there are no consequences. The buildings are occupied. Has anyone called the Kosovo police or those in the buildings to leave and go back to where they were? "Nobody", emphasizes Odalovic.

He points out that he has instruments and says that there is no doubt that those who loudly call them not to do something, can prevent it and remedy the consequences.

"This day is very uncertain and causes great concern. "These are sleepless nights for the Serbs in the area of ​​Kosovo and Metohija, because this kind of brutality was not expected and this sequence of moves was not expected," says Odalović.

He believes that the biggest mistake of the international community is that it gave itself the right to declare as legal the results of the elections that the Serbs boycotted.

Odalovic points out that the decision to suspend classes in the north of Kosovo is rational.

"The brutality shown by members of the Kosovo Police Force shows that children should be sheltered and kept safe because we don't know what they are up to." It is certain that we do not know what they could do," Odalovic points out. .
